    Devin isn't a memer. His music is all intensely personal to him and he gets anxious preforming, so he hides it all behind humor and his infectious stage presence. Even this song he explained is about him exploring things he's always wanted to explore (stage music and Broadway musicals) but was too scared to. He's been my favorite musician for years because of how humble he is. He was a pleasure to meet in person, too.

    More or less how the the Casualties of Cool project came about - he worked remotely with Ché Aimee Dorval to write the songs and lay some demo tracks as a method of decompressing while on one of his more punishing tours.

    That wasn't a children's choir, it was Elektra Women's Choir. Devy has used them on a lot of tracks on several recordings. Cheers
